I’m disappointed that the viewing of a pdf on a mobile device is not permitted. I’m hoping to migrate my phpBB site to Discourse, because phpBB is clunky - but, I’ve hacked a feature into my board using pdf.js that permits me to embed pdfs. And pdf.js permits you to zoom and pan - while it’s not as robust as on the desktop, it’s useful in the garage to scan a manual without having to run back into the house. This example is not that of a manual, but demonstrates the principle: Bulletin #361 - A Diesel in America
Facebook is eating my lunch, and primarily with mobile devices - I’m hoping to win users back with a Discourse integration. But losing pdf on the handheld is not a win for me.
